A Postgraduate Certificate in Gene Regulation for Synthetic Biology equips students with advanced knowledge and practical skills in manipulating gene expression for various biotechnological applications. This specialized program focuses on the intricate mechanisms governing gene regulation, providing a strong foundation for careers in synthetic biology.
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of gene regulatory networks, CRISPR-Cas systems, transcriptional and translational control, and the design of synthetic gene circuits. Students will develop proficiency in experimental techniques such as cloning, gene editing, and high-throughput screening relevant to genetic engineering and metabolic engineering.
The duration of such a program varies, but generally ranges from six months to a year, often structured as part-time or full-time study depending on the institution's offering. The intensive curriculum often blends theoretical lectures with hands-on laboratory experiences.
